    About the Development Competition

    TCO10-Development-About-Content

    The Development Competition includes the following tracks: Assembly, Component Development, Prototypes, and Testing Suites.

    Competitors will have from March 29 - July 30, 2010 to compete and accumulate points leading up to the Finals, being held at the Mirage Hotel in Las Vegas, Nevada, USA from October 11 - 14, 2010. The top fifteen scorers including the Champion will win this fabulous trip to Las Vegas!

    Rules

    The 2010 TopCoder Open Development Competition (“Development Competition”) will take place between March 29 and July 30, 2010. The Development Competition will include the following tracks of competition: Assembly, Component Development, Prototypes and Testing Suites. The Development Competition will consist of online qualifying competitions, with up to fifteen (15) of the highest scoring Competitors from the Development Competition winning a trip to the Tournament. The Development Competition is part of the Tournament, and by participating in the competition, you agree to these rules.

    Schedule

    Competitors can register for the Tournament and be eligible for the Development Competition between 9:00 UTC -4 on March 29, 2010 and 9:00 UTC -4 on July 30, 2010. The Development Competition will take place between March 29, 2010 and July 30, 2010 (“Development Competition Period”).

    During the Development Competition Period, Competitors who have registered for the Development Competition and who participate in Tournament-eligible Development competitions (as applicable) on the TopCoder website, will receive points as outlined in these Rules. A Competitor’s submission will not be scored separately for the Development Competition. Only Tournament-eligible Development competitions in which registration has closed during the Development Competition Period shall be included in determining points for the Development Competition.

    Competition Scoring

    Scoring in the Development Competition is determined based on the final placement for a Competitor’s submission in a Tournament-eligible Development competition (as applicable) in accordance with the rules of such competition. A Development competition is Tournament-eligible if the competition is identified as being included as part of the Tournament. Only Competitors who are registered for the Tournament will be considered in determining place and placement points. Placement scoring mirrors the Digital Run placement scoring, and is as follows (where Placement Points for a contest equal the number of DR points that contest offers). (Scores will be rounded to two decimal places.)

    Percentage of Placement Points

    # of Submissions that Pass Review:

    Place12345
    1st100%70%65%60%56%
    2nd 30%25%22%20%
    3rd 10%10%10%
    4th 8%8%
    5th 6%

    If more than five (5) submissions pass review, the competitors who place in 6th position or below will not receive any placement points.

    Penalties

    All final fixes will be completed according to the applicable schedule. On a case-by-case basis, as determined by TopCoder staff, placement points may be deducted for failing to complete final fixes on time.

    Placement/Advancement

    Up to fifteen (15) Competitors with the highest cumulative placement score in the Development Competition in Tournament-eligible competitions will be invited to attend the onsite awards ceremony at the Tournament.

    In the event of a tie, the tie will be resolved in the following manner:

    1. The tied competitor with the highest number of first place submissions will receive a higher placement in the Development Competition.
    2. If a tie still remains, then the remaining tied competitor with the highest number of second place submissions will receive a higher placement in the Development Competition.
    3. If a tie still remains, then the remaining tied competitor with the highest number of third place submissions will receive a higher placement in the Development Competition.
    4. If a tie still remains, then the remaining tied competitor with the highest number of fourth place submissions will receive a higher placement in the Development Competition.
    5. If a tie still remains, then all remaining tied competitors will receive the same placement.

    About the Prizes

    The Development Competition will award up to $30,250. Any and all applicable taxes on prizes are the sole responsibility of the prizewinner.

    Competitor(s)Prize
    1st place finisher*$20,000
    2nd place finisher*$5,000
    3rd place finisher*$1,500
    4th place finisher*$1,000 each
    5th-15th place finisher*$250 each
    Up to the first 50 Competitors with the highest amount of points (minimum of 15 placement points)Limited edition 2010 TopCoder Open t-shirt

    * Prize will be awarded during the onsite Awards Presentation at the Tournament. The winner must be present at the onsite Awards Presentation to receive prize.

    Prior to Competitors receiving their cash prize, they must complete all work for all underlying Development competitions and Tournament and Development Competition-related work, such as final fixes.
